Discreetly located fifty meters from the cliff, We'll notice macaws with environmentally friendly, scarlet and blue and gold wings and several species of scaled-down parrots descend to ingest clay. Departures are at dawn when the lick is most Lively.

The best time to visit is through the dry period, from May to September. That is if you can see much more wildlife and revel in better weather for outside activities.
